HAZELWORT Meaning and Definition

  1. Hazelwort, also known by its scientific name Asarum europaeum, is a perennial plant belonging to the family Aristolochiaceae. It is native to Europe and can be found growing in shaded woodland areas, often alongside hazel trees.

    The Hazelwort plant typically has heart-shaped leaves that grow in a basal rosette. These leaves are dark green and have a glossy appearance. The plant also produces unique bell-shaped, purplish-brown flowers that are often hidden beneath the foliage. These flowers emerge in spring and emit a pungent scent to attract pollinators, such as flies.

    In terms of medicinal uses, Hazelwort has a long history of being used in traditional herbal medicine. It is primarily known for its diuretic properties, helping to increase urine production and promote kidney health. Furthermore, it has been used to alleviate various digestive complaints, such as indigestion and flatulence.

    It is worth noting that Hazelwort contains certain chemical compounds, including aristolochic acid, which have been associated with potential toxicity. As a result, caution should be exercised when using this plant for medicinal purposes.

Etymology of HAZELWORT

The word "hazelwort" is derived from the Old English term "haeselwyrt", which combines "haesel" (meaning hazel) and "wyrt" (meaning plant or root). The term refers to a plant known for its hazel-shaped leaves or its association with hazel trees.
